vidaXL Coupons & Deals
vidaXL is a global internet shop headquartered in Venlo, the Netherlands. We have a startling selection of products, including home and garden, furnishings, sporting equipment, and many others. It began in 2006 with the small-scale online sale of merchandise on several platforms.